Radiant Exchange is focused on developing and deploying outdoor cooling and heating systems to benefit people in outdoor labor, recreation, and leisure activities. We want to make it possible to be happy and healthy in the increasingly difficult world of extremes of heat and cold.

Gregory Kiss has worked to advance the art and science of integrated environmental design for more than 30 years. He pioneered Building Integrated Photovoltaics, designing several of the first true BIPV commercial buildings in the US, and authored a series of early technical reports for the DOE/NREL as well as for NYSERDA.

Mahadev Raman is currently Chair of Arup Trustees Board. He has also served as Director of Arup University, member of Arup Group Board and Chair of the Americas. He is also a faculty member at the Princeton University School of Architecture where he teaches environmental and net-zero energy building design.

Rowan Bortz, with a background in bioengineering, is focusing on architecture, building engineering, and data analysis at Kiss-Architects and Radiant Exchange. Over the last two years she has applied and advanced current research on the role of radiative heat transfer in thermal comfort. She leads the development of key hardware and software systems for the radiant pavilions.
